(Rajendra) Sasural (1961)

Here is a super hit movie from L.V. Prasad. It was based on the Telugu hit "Illarikam (1959)". The story itself was very very loosely based on Sharat's novel "Kashinath". I am not sure whether Sharatji ever imagined that his novel could be made into such an entertainer.

The movie has all the "masala" ingredients that make up for a crowd pleaser. On the top of it the music of Shankar & Jaikishan has some beautiful tracks to go with it. Most of the songs were huge hits when the movie was released with the standout song of the album the led all the charts, Rafi Saab's lovely romantic number, "Teri Pyaari Pyaari Soorat Ko".

(Sunil) Gumrah (1963)

Here is another film from B.R. Chopra that was a huge hit. The subject deals with a husband tormenting his wife to mend her ways because he suspects that she may be unfaithful. The movie boasts some fine performances by Mala Sinha and Ashok Kumar. But it is the music that is the main reason I think that the movie became such a huge winner. It is the combination of Ravi and Sahir again. As has been the case umpteen number of times before this, the music and songs for this film are no exception. Ravi utilizes talents of only two singers here, that of Asha and Mahendra. Mahendra especially comes through shining with several great songs. There are so many great songs in this movie that it is really difficult to single out one over another. All of the solos by Mahendra and his duets with Asha are just outstanding. I have a couple of favorites in this album. The solo by Mahendra "Aa Bhi Jaa" is just an absolute beauty. Very few words. But the way the song was composed and executed is just lovely. Another of my favorite is the duet "Aaja Aaja Re". Great lyrics. Lovely singing. Melodious music. The whole experience becomes such a sweet memory.

(Dharmendra) Anupama (1966)

This beautiful movie was directed by Hrishikesh Mukherjee. He was a master of taking some simple subjects and turning them into simply superb movies. There are several examples of this, like “Anari (1959)”, “Anand (1970)”, “Mili 91975)”, and host of others. This film, “Anupama”, is definitely one such movie.

I will count this as one of his top movies. It is one of my favorites. The only way to describe this movie is to borrow its own title.

Sharmila Tagore, stunningly beautiful, gave a smashing performance. From a father-fearing innocent woman to romance awakened lover to a rebellious spirited person, the whole gamut of spectrum of transformation was superbly performed by Sharmila.

Dharmendra gave one of his rare subdued performances. Not since Bimal Roy's "Bandini" that he displayed such a restrained performance. Too bad he did not act in more movies like this one. Instead he ended up as another he-man turned action hero with so many utterly forgettable movies.

Then there is Hemantda's superb music. There are only five songs in this movie. But each one of them sparkles like a gem. He is joined here with some great lyrics penned by Kaifi Azmi. I have several favorites in this album, including Asha's lovely "Bheegi Bheegi Faza", Lata's sweet "Kuchh Dil Ne Kaha", and Hemantda's touching solo "Ya Dil Ki Suno".
